Section 1: The Science of Estrogens and Muscle Growth
Despite being primarily known for female functions, they are important for men’s overall health.
Current findings demonstrate that estrogens can influence post-exercise recovery. I found that managing estrogen is as important as boosting testosterone for optimizing strength training.
Achieving the right mix of male hormones and estrogens dictates muscle-building potential. Both excess and deficiency in estrogen may impair training recovery and development.
Take for example, if estrogen levels become too high, it can lead to increased fat deposition and reduced muscle definition, On the other hand, insufficient estrogen could limit recovery and performance.

Section 1: Understanding Estrogen Blockers
Estrogen blockers work to diminish excess estrogen within the system. Many natural supplements contain ingredients such as DIM, calcium D-glucarate, and chrysin to support a balanced endocrine system for muscle growth.
Evidence points to estrogen inhibitors target the aromatase enzyme to reduce estrogen production. With reduced estrogen levels can lead to an improved testosterone-to-estrogen ratio, and ultimately enhancing gym performance and bodybuilding results.
